The FAGUS H Multi Use Belt Squat Attachment is a versatile and adjustable fitness tool designed to enhance your leg workouts. With a length range of 28”-46.5”, it fits various power racks and supports multiple exercises, ensuring a tailored experience for users of all sizes. Made from durable steel and backed by a 2-year warranty, this attachment is perfect for both casual gym-goers and serious athletes.

Good for Moderate Weight
Meets my current needs from a weight capacity and cost perspective. If you plan to do heavy weights or have the budget go with the Fringe Mammoth version w/ kickstand. The main difference appears to be the gauge of metal used. Fagus weighs approx. 13 lbs and the Mammoth is listed at 32 lbs. I replaced the wingnuts with bolts and built my own kickstand. I've been using it for belt squats, rows, and RDL's. Overall happy with it.

Gets the job done!
This belt squat is a fraction of the price of the Mammoth and I believe it's identical. Seems to be well made, certainly doesn't seem cheap. The spindle is 13 inches, so I think I could put at least 6 x 45 lb plates on it, although I haven't tried yet. Doesn't include a belt, so I got one from Rogue. Overall very good, but not as nice as a real belt squat machine in the gym, but what do you expect for such a low cost?
